Dallas Cowboys cornerback Trevon Diggs publicly apologized for a heated exchange with a reporter following the team's loss to the San Francisco 49ers. Diggs reacted defensively to criticism regarding his effort on a specific play involving George Kittle, but later clarified his actions and expressed frustration over the team's recent performance. He acknowledged that losing has been tough on him and emphasized his desire to win.
